Output 3750ccbdc603c534d8f468985a3c14a2a081edff7d75097a62c76d9141723adf:6

value
170087767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35c012cecf500c9e5edbdf5ec2d7bf63de61e186 OP_EQUAL
address
36bDqD6KwVDoN1zg6K3xecbGLJME11HqTq
transaction
3750ccbdc603c534d8f468985a3c14a2a081edff7d75097a62c76d9141723adf
spent
true